Here we help out a client and family friend grade out the side yard against his driveway to allow for an approachable space to maintain, as well as redirect water shedding from the hill and driveway. It was a rough start with the equipment, but we got it done! This job would have certainly been quite tedious had we not had the skid steer!

Equipment Used:
Excavator: 2021 Bobcat E26 R-Series
Skid Steer: 2021 Bobcat T66 CTL R-Series
Tractor: 2019 Kubota BX23s
